Velvet Repose

When You Need Something Gentle to End the Day

The best nightcaps don't shout. They whisper you toward sleep with just enough warmth and sweetness to make you forget whatever the day threw at you. The Velvet Repose does exactly that, leaning into ruby port's natural plushness and dark fruit flavors without any of the fuss. The cognac adds a gentle backbone, keeping things refined while the Bénédictine brings its signature honeyed spice. Those orange bitters tie everything together with a subtle citrus note that keeps the drink from feeling too heavy. It's spirit-forward but not aggressive, sweet but not cloying. Think of it as a more relaxed, approachable cousin to classics like the Vieux Carré or Sazerac. This is the drink for when you want to sit in a comfortable chair with a good book, or just stare out the window and decompress. The Nick & Nora glass keeps the pour modest, which is exactly right for something this rich. Give it a try next time you need to transition from the chaos of evening into actual rest.

Ingredients

  • 2 ozruby port
  • 0.75 ozcognac
  • 0.25 ozBénédictine
  • 2 dashesRegan's Orange Bitters No. 6

Method

  1. 1.Add all ingredients to a mixing glass with ice
  2. 2.Stir gently for 20-25 seconds until well-chilled
  3. 3.Strain into a chilled Nick & Nora glass
  4. 4.Express orange peel over the drink and discard or place in glass
Garnishorange peel twist

Note: A peaceful nightcap in the style of classic after-dinner cocktails. The port brings natural sweetness and body, supported by cognac's elegance and Bénédictine's honeyed herbal complexity. Perfect for slow sipping before bed.
